Common Influenza Flu Symptoms
Influenza, commonly known as the flu, is a viral infection that mainly affects the respiratory system. Common symptoms include high fever, chills, sore throat, cough, runny or blocked nose, headache, body aches, fatigue, and weakness. In some cases, people may also experience nausea, vomiting, or diarrhea, especially children.
Symptoms typically start rapidly and range from mild to severe. Older folks, small children, pregnant women, and those with compromised immune systems are more likely to experience problems.

Treatment and Care

Most flu cases can be treated at home with adequate rest and care. Drinking enough of fluids, getting enough sleep, and taking over-the-counter drugs to lower temperature and physical pain can all help to alleviate symptoms. Doctors may give antiviral medications in some circumstances, particularly for high-risk individuals, if therapy is initiated early.
Safety Precautions
To limit the risk of influenza, health professionals urge frequent handwashing, avoiding direct contact with sick people, and wearing a mask in public places during flu outbreaks. Getting a yearly flu vaccine is also regarded as one of the most efficient ways to avoid serious disease.
